Buhler Bowling Continues Winning Ways, Sweeps Crusader Classic

HUTCHINSON, Kan. – Buhler bowling added to its impressive resume on Saturday, sweeping the Crusader Classic at The Alley in Hutchinson. Against a field that included 11 over schools, the Buhler boys rallied after a slow start to win over by 156 points over second place Eisenhower.

  1. Buhler 3327
  2. Eisenhower 3171
  3. Emporia 3051
  4. Cheney 2885
  5. Goddard 2815
  6. El Dorado 2794
  7. Circle 2753
  8. Andover 2744
  9. Salina Central 2737
  10. Valley Center 2542
  11. Newton 2459
  12. Solomon 1913

Medalists:

Trent Sheridan: 2nd place

Cotton Pyles: 6th place

Boys Series Scores:

Trent Sheridan: 185, 237, 244 = 666

Cotton Pyles: 157, 252, 201 = 610

Jax Frederick: 196, 171, 215 = 582

Malachi Willis: 149, 200, 225 = 574

Landon Kurtz: 158, 224, 155 = 537

Gage Warren: 176, 138, 149 = 463

The Buhler girls made the most of the Baker round to go from third to first and earn an 80-point win over second-place Emporia.

  1. Buhler 2631
  2. Emporia 2551
  3. Goddard 2526
  4. Salina Central 2444
  5. Eisenhower 2443
  6. Andover 2256
  7. Circle 2218
  8. Cheney 1997
  9. Valley Center 1944
  10. Newton 1914
  11. El Dorado 1835

Medalists:

Emily Duran: 7th place

Samantha Hulse: 10th

Girls Series Scores:

Emily Duran: 170, 160, 165 = 495

Samantha Hulse: 156, 135, 178 = 469

Kenzie Welch: 115, 198, 153 = 466

Teigan Nielsen: 150, 134, 170 = 454

Sloane Adkins: 139, 116, 135 = 390

 

The Crusaders have a pair of home dates this week on Monday and Friday – they then conclude the regular season on Saturday in Wichita.
